func TestValidate(t *testing.T) {
t.Run("Accepts the default options as valid", func(t *testing.T) {
if err := testInstallOptions().validate(); err != nil {
t.Fatalf("Unexpected error: %s", err)
}
})
t.Run("Rejects invalid controller log level", func(t *testing.T) {
options := testInstallOptions()
options.controllerLogLevel = "super"
expected := "--controller-log-level must be one of: panic, fatal, error, warn, info, debug"
err := options.validate()
if err == nil {
t.Fatal("Expected error, got nothing")
}
if err.Error() != expected {
t.Fatalf("Expected error string\"%s\", got \"%s\"", expected, err)
}
})
t.Run("Properly validates proxy log level", func(t *testing.T) {
testCases := []struct {
input string
valid bool
}{
{"", false},
{"info", true},
{"somemodule", true},
{"bad%name", false},
{"linkerd2_proxy=debug", true},
{"linkerd2%proxy=debug", false},
{"linkerd2_proxy=foobar", false},
{"linker2d_proxy,std::option", true},
{"warn,linkerd2_proxy=info", true},
{"warn,linkerd2_proxy=foobar", false},
}
options := testInstallOptions()
for _, tc := range testCases {
options.proxyLogLevel = tc.input
err := options.validate()
if tc.valid && err != nil {
t.Fatalf("Error not expected: %s", err)
}
if !tc.valid && err == nil {
t.Fatalf("Expected error string \"%s is not a valid proxy log level\", got nothing", tc.input)
}
expectedErr := fmt.Sprintf("\"%s\" is not a valid proxy log level - for allowed syntax check https://docs.rs/env_logger/0.6.0/env_logger/#enabling-logging", tc.input)
if tc.input == "" {
expectedErr = "--proxy-log-level must not be empty"
}
if !tc.valid && err.Error() != expectedErr {
t.Fatalf("Expected error string \"%s\", got \"%s\"; input=\"%s\"", expectedErr, err, tc.input)
}
}
})
}
